Provisional squad was up on itv football.

 

 

Quote from Lambert this afternoon...

 

 

The Scot will speak with Richard Dunne at training today to see whether the veteran Republic of Ireland centre-half is ready to be thrown back into the fold following a six-month absence with groin and hip problems.


 

That addition should help as Lambert explained what is missing.


 

'I need people who are prepared to be cut in the penalty area,' he said. 'People who don't mind having a clash of heads.


 

'I can believe the supporters are upset by what's happened. They are probably saying the same things as I'm saying.


 

'But when a ball comes into the box, you have to be prepared to be hurt. It's you against me in the box and you have to be wanting to do it.
